QUESTION: Illustrated below is a commonly used procedure for determining the density of an irregularly shaped, water-insoluble solid. The solid is weighed, then submerged in water. Suppose the solid weighed 48.0 g and the water level in the cylinder rose from 20.9 mL to 26.9 mL The density of the solid is... A g/mL, B g/mL C g/mL, D g/mL PAUSE CLICK Density is defined as the ratio of mass to volume. Therefore, to calculate density, we simply divide the mass by the volume. We are given that the mass is 48.0 grams. HIGHLIGHT 48.0 g in problem The volume of the object is equal to the volume of water displaced. We calculate this by taking the difference between the final water level and initial water level in the cylinder. CLICK The volume is 26.9 mL minus 20.9 mL, CLICK or 6.0 mL Therefore, the density is CLICK the mass grams HIGHLIGHT 48.0 g divided by the volume mL HIGHLIGHT 8.0 mL which gives us 8 grams per milliliter. Since 48.0 has 3 significant digits and 6.0 has two significant digits, the less precise term is 6.0 and we should express our answer to two significant digits.
